Can one PC handle gaming and streaming?

Yes. A correctly balanced modern PC can run a game and stream at the same time, particularly when supported GPU encoding is used.

Is 32GB of RAM enough for streaming?

For most gaming, OBS, browser sources, Discord and recording setups, 32GB is a practical target. Heavy editing and professional production may benefit from 64GB.

Streaming resolution and gaming resolution are not always the same

A customer can play a game at 1440p or 4K while broadcasting at 1080p. This is often a more practical arrangement than sending a native 4K livestream because the broadcast resolution must also suit the streaming platform, video bitrate and available upload bandwidth.

A powerful 4K gaming and streaming PC provides greater graphics headroom, but the correct output resolution still depends on the platform and the audience. Customers planning a premium high-resolution setup can compare the systems on the CAA Computers 4K Gaming PC Australia page.

A high-performance streaming desktop cannot compensate for unstable internet, unsuitable bitrate settings or unreliable Wi-Fi. The PC, network connection and broadcasting configuration must work together.

Why wired Ethernet is usually better for livestreaming

A reliable network connection is one of the most overlooked parts of a streaming setup. Wi-Fi may be convenient, but interference, distance from the router and network congestion can create fluctuations that affect the broadcast. Where possible, a streaming desktop computer should be connected through wired Ethernet.

The internet connection needs consistent upload performance rather than only a high advertised download speed. Anyone preparing a PC for Twitch streaming, YouTube Live or another livestreaming service should test upload stability before choosing aggressive bitrate or resolution settings.

Audio quality can matter more than visual effects

A good streaming PC is only one part of a professional broadcast. Viewers may tolerate reduced image quality, but distorted, inconsistent or noisy audio can quickly make a stream difficult to watch. Streamers should consider microphone quality, room noise, audio-interface compatibility and USB connectivity when planning the complete system.

Customers using several USB devices should confirm that the motherboard has enough rear and front connections for the microphone, webcam, stream controller, headset, capture card and external storage. A custom streaming PC can be configured around these requirements before assembly.

Webcams, cameras and capture devices

A standard USB webcam normally connects directly to the streaming computer. More advanced creators may use a mirrorless camera or professional camera through an HDMI capture device. Console streamers and dual-PC users may also require a capture card.

Why local stream recordings need additional storage

Many streamers broadcast and record at the same time. Local recordings can be used for YouTube uploads, highlights, short-form clips and edited videos, but high-quality recordings can consume storage rapidly. A 1TB drive may be suitable for a starter streaming PC, while a regular creator may benefit from 2TB, 4TB or a separate recording drive.

Separating applications, games and recordings across multiple drives can also make media management easier. Customers who regularly edit long broadcasts should consider a larger NVMe SSD and an additional backup solution rather than relying on a single drive.

Streaming and video editing place different demands on a PC

A gaming PC for streaming and editing must perform well during the live broadcast and after it ends. Editing applications can benefit from additional processor cores, more memory, larger storage and GPU acceleration. This is different from a system designed only to maximise gaming frame rates.

Creators producing edited YouTube videos, advertisements, podcasts or social-media clips should consider a professional creator system with at least 32GB of memory and enough storage for raw footage, project files, cache data and exported videos. A streaming PC should support multiple monitors

Many livestreaming setups use one display for the game and another for OBS, chat, alerts or monitoring. Some creators add a third screen for production tools, editing or administrative work. The selected graphics card should offer the correct display outputs for the monitors being used.

Monitor resolution and refresh rate also affect GPU load. A gaming and streaming computer running a high-refresh 1440p display has different demands from a basic 1080p streaming desktop. The system should be chosen around the actual display setup rather than a generic specification target.

Streaming software should be configured for the individual setup

There is no single OBS setting that is correct for every streaming PC. Encoder choice, resolution, frame rate, bitrate, recording format and scene complexity should be adjusted according to the computer, internet connection and streaming platform.

Cooling and noise during long livestreams

A livestream may run for several hours while the processor, graphics card, memory, storage and network hardware remain active. A streaming rig therefore needs dependable airflow and sensible fan placement. A visually impressive case is not useful if restricted ventilation causes high temperatures or excessive fan noise.

Microphones can also capture noisy fans when the computer is placed close to the streamer. Good cooling does not mean every fan must run at maximum speed. Balanced airflow, suitable cooling hardware and proper fan control can improve both temperatures and acoustic performance.

Planning for future streaming PC upgrades

A good streaming computer should be expandable where possible. Common future upgrades include more storage, additional memory, a stronger graphics card, a capture card, extra USB connectivity or a newer processor supported by the motherboard.
